And then it froze. Pinned to its spot, its owner also unnaturally still, his face frozen in a grotesque grimace. A gargoyle of flesh and blood. The very fabric of the universe rippled, and then imploded in a burst of miniscule numbers. Ones and zeros. Collapsing inwards in a cascade of code. The endless matrix of numbers, once unseen, now visible. And from the digits a face was chiselled. It was bearded, wise, ancient and powerful. A primeval elder, forged of code. Steve stared in awe as the most guarded secrets of his world came to light in this shimmering hologram. Then the apparition parted its jaws, and uttered an explanation. It was Java. And he was Notch. "Steve," Notch boomed. "Yes?" Came Steve's fearful, shaky reply. "I have need of you, Steve. That is why I have brought you here. To the arena." Steve questioned Notch, slightly angry: "But didn't the monsters capture me? If you really did bring me here, why should I help you?" The primeval compilation of Java responded swiftly. "They did indeed drag you from your home, but I led them to you. There is a task that only you can accomplish." Steve pondered this, confused, and thrust forth a question. "If you are indeed so powerful as to control the monsters, to twist the fate of the world around your finger, why can't you solve it yourself?" Notch answered with a sigh, gazing forlornly through the matrix of endless script. "I have tried. Many times. Listen to me, Steve. For every ten lines of Java here, on digit is corrupt. Together, these digits form an entity. It cannot be destroyed or reshaped by any external program. It must be destroyed from within, and I reside without. This monstrous entity is the Arena Master. I cannot remove him, I cannot delete him, I cannot change him. Out here, he goes by a different name. In my world, his name is Herobrine. He is my counterpart, my rival. I cannot defeat him. But you can." Steve, overwhelmed with a sense of dizziness, rose unsteadily to his feet. "How?" He asked timidly. Notch extended an arm constructed of digits, and waved it through the grid of Java. The code rippled. "I can shape your world," He answered. "I will guide you. Now, you must return to your world, and I must return to mine. But before I do, I can present you with a token of my trust. I believe in you, Steve. You were born of my work, you and I are one through space and time." And with these final words, the holographic image of Javascript dissolved, along with the entire grid, cascading and reshaping until it formed a familiar landscape. The arena. Steve collapsed to his hands and knees, abruptly vomiting into the coarse sand. "How can this be!?" The Arena Master screeched. Steve rose in confusion, still slightly retching, and gasped in astonishment. Upon the sands before him lay a glittering sword.
